Bill Summary
Recognizing the 74th annual National Day of Prayer, May 1, 2025.
AI Summary
This resolution recognizes the 74th annual National Day of Prayer on May 1, 2025, and highlights the historical significance of prayer in American society. The resolution traces the origins of the National Day of Prayer to a 1952 Congressional joint action that requested the President to designate an annual day of prayer, which was later officially set as the first Thursday in May through legislation in 1988 and 1998. The document emphasizes the importance of religious freedom as established by the founding fathers and encourages Ohioans to reflect on the role of religion in society and the constitutional rights of freedom of worship. The Ohio House of Representatives formally acknowledges this day, recognizing how prayer has been a source of guidance, wisdom, and strength throughout the nation's history during various challenges and periods. The resolution not only commemorates the day but also calls on all Ohioans to participate in this observance, and directs the House Clerk to distribute authenticated copies of the resolution to Ohio's news media.
